7. WrestleMania XXXI Whats Going To Happen?
A great many WWE fans only buy one Pay Per View a year, WrestleMania. The event, then, is a great way to pick up new/lapsed fans by showcasing the WWE product at its very best. WWE seems to be building towards a Cena/Lesnar main event at WrestleMania XXXI, which will likely be both predictable and bland to watch. Lesnar will be picking up a paycheque and Cena will be doing what weve seen him do hundreds of times before, winning the match with his patented five moves of doom and leaving the building as The Champ. Again. As main events go though, thats probably the best way to play it. Besides, its probably too late to do anything else now, anyway. What WWE should be doing, however, is augmenting the rest of the card with some real surprises. Lets see some NXT talent being called up to the main roster and getting to debut in front of WWEs biggest crowd of the year. Yeah, Lesnar vs. Cena might not be your cup of tea, but show me someone who wouldnt pay good money to watch Kevin Owens, Adrian Neville, Sami Zayn and others mix it up with WWEs main roster on the biggest stage of them all. A surprise win here could really make a new star very quickly, in addition to building a solid fanbase from the ground up. WrestleMania XXXI is the perfect opportunity to showcase the WWEs fresh talent reservoir, so that audiences in 2015 are pumped and primed to watch a newer, more exciting WWE product.
